A watermelon color gradient seamlessly transitions from deep red at the top to bright green at the bottom, mimicking the iconic fruit’s natural split. This gradient balances warmth and freshness, making it ideal for summer-themed visuals, packaging, and digital interfaces. Its distinct layering creates depth without overwhelming the viewer, offering versatility across design disciplines.

Creating a smooth watermelon gradient requires precise color selection: start with a rich red or magenta at the top, blending into a vibrant lime green at the base. Use tools like Adobe Color or CSS gradient functions to achieve seamless transitions. Optimize for accessibility by maintaining sufficient contrast, ensuring your gradient remains effective across devices and lighting conditions.

Watermelon Color Scheme The Watermelon Color Scheme has 4 colors, which are Watermelon (#F35588), Melon (#FFBBB4), Bud Green (#71A95A) and Dartmouth Green (#007944). The RGB and CMYK values of the colors are in the table below along with the closest RAL and PANTONE® numbers.
